Pharmaceutical companies have invested heavily in the development of androgen therapies for female sexual desire disorders, but today there are still no FDA approved androgen therapies for women. Nonetheless, testosterone is currently, and frequently, prescribed off-label for the treatment of low sexual desire in women, and the idea of testosterone as a cure-all for female sexual dysfunction remains popular. These studies demonstrate that estrogen-only therapies that produce periovulatory levels of circulating estradiol increase sexual desire in postmenopausal women. Ovarian steroids estradiol, testosterone, and progesterone modulate sexual desire, or libido, in women. The gradual and age-related cessation of ovarian function associated with natural menopause decreases levels of ovarian steroids, accompanied by diminished sexual desire in a significant portion of postmenopausal women Dennerstein et al. Similarly, women who undergo bilateral oophorectomy surgical menopause routinely report a post-operative decline in sexual desire after experiencing an abrupt and pronounced drop in circulating levels of ovarian steroids Dennerstein et al. Both estradiol and testosterone have been implicated as the steroid that critically modulates sexual desire in women; although, estradiol seems at first glance to be the more likely candidate for this role.
